Prepare for moving drm_fb_helper modesetting code to drm_client.
drm_client will be linked to drm.ko, so move
__drm_atomic_helper_disable_plane() and __drm_atomic_helper_set_config()
out of drm_kms_helper.ko.

diff --git a/drivers/gpu/drm/drm_atomic.c b/drivers/gpu/drm/drm_atomic.c
index 7d25c42f22db..1fb602b6c8b1 100644
--- a/drivers/gpu/drm/drm_atomic.c
+++ b/drivers/gpu/drm/drm_atomic.c
@@ -2060,6 +2060,174 @@ void drm_atomic_clean_old_fb(struct drm_device *dev,
 }
 EXPORT_SYMBOL(drm_atomic_clean_old_fb);
 
+/* just used from drm_client and atomic-helper: */
+int drm_atomic_disable_plane(struct drm_plane *plane,
+                            struct drm_plane_state *plane_state)
+{
+       int ret;
+
+       ret = drm_atomic_set_crtc_for_plane(plane_state, NULL);
+       if (ret != 0)
+               return ret;
+
+       drm_atomic_set_fb_for_plane(plane_state, NULL);
+       plane_state->crtc_x = 0;
+       plane_state->crtc_y = 0;
+       plane_state->crtc_w = 0;
+       plane_state->crtc_h = 0;
+       plane_state->src_x = 0;
+       plane_state->src_y = 0;
+       plane_state->src_w = 0;
+       plane_state->src_h = 0;
+
+       return 0;
+}
+EXPORT_SYMBOL(drm_atomic_disable_plane);
+
+static int update_output_state(struct drm_atomic_state *state,
+                              struct drm_mode_set *set)
+{
+       struct drm_device *dev = set->crtc->dev;
+       struct drm_crtc *crtc;
+       struct drm_crtc_state *new_crtc_state;
+       struct drm_connector *connector;
+       struct drm_connector_state *new_conn_state;
+       int ret, i;
+
+       ret = drm_modeset_lock(&dev->mode_config.connection_mutex,
+                              state->acquire_ctx);
+       if (ret)
+               return ret;
+
+       /* First disable all connectors on the target crtc. */
+       ret = drm_atomic_add_affected_connectors(state, set->crtc);
+       if (ret)
+               return ret;
+
+       for_each_new_connector_in_state(state, connector, new_conn_state, i) {
+               if (new_conn_state->crtc == set->crtc) {
+                       ret = drm_atomic_set_crtc_for_connector(new_conn_state,
+                                                               NULL);
+                       if (ret)
+                               return ret;
+
+                       /* Make sure legacy setCrtc always re-trains */
+                       new_conn_state->link_status = DRM_LINK_STATUS_GOOD;
+               }
+       }
+
+       /* Then set all connectors from set->connectors on the target crtc */
+       for (i = 0; i < set->num_connectors; i++) {
+               new_conn_state = drm_atomic_get_connector_state(state,
+                                                           set->connectors[i]);
+               if (IS_ERR(new_conn_state))
+                       return PTR_ERR(new_conn_state);
+
+               ret = drm_atomic_set_crtc_for_connector(new_conn_state,
+                                                       set->crtc);
+               if (ret)
+                       return ret;
+       }
+
+       for_each_new_crtc_in_state(state, crtc, new_crtc_state, i) {
+               /*
+                * Don't update ->enable for the CRTC in the set_config request,
+                * since a mismatch would indicate a bug in the upper layers.
+                * The actual modeset code later on will catch any
+                * inconsistencies here.
+                */
+               if (crtc == set->crtc)
+                       continue;
+
+               if (!new_crtc_state->connector_mask) {
+                       ret = drm_atomic_set_mode_prop_for_crtc(new_crtc_state,
+                                                               NULL);
+                       if (ret < 0)
+                               return ret;
+
+                       new_crtc_state->active = false;
+               }
+       }
+
+       return 0;
+}
+
+/* just used from drm_client and atomic-helper: */
+int drm_atomic_set_config(struct drm_mode_set *set,
+                         struct drm_atomic_state *state)
+{
+       struct drm_crtc_state *crtc_state;
+       struct drm_plane_state *primary_state;
+       struct drm_crtc *crtc = set->crtc;
+       int hdisplay, vdisplay;
+       int ret;
+
+       crtc_state = drm_atomic_get_crtc_state(state, crtc);
+       if (IS_ERR(crtc_state))
+               return PTR_ERR(crtc_state);
+
+       primary_state = drm_atomic_get_plane_state(state, crtc->primary);
+       if (IS_ERR(primary_state))
+               return PTR_ERR(primary_state);
+
+       if (!set->mode) {
+               WARN_ON(set->fb);
+               WARN_ON(set->num_connectors);
+
+               ret = drm_atomic_set_mode_for_crtc(crtc_state, NULL);
+               if (ret != 0)
+                       return ret;
+
+               crtc_state->active = false;
+
+               ret = drm_atomic_set_crtc_for_plane(primary_state, NULL);
+               if (ret != 0)
+                       return ret;
+
+               drm_atomic_set_fb_for_plane(primary_state, NULL);
+
+               goto commit;
+       }
+
+       WARN_ON(!set->fb);
+       WARN_ON(!set->num_connectors);
+
+       ret = drm_atomic_set_mode_for_crtc(crtc_state, set->mode);
+       if (ret != 0)
+               return ret;
+
+       crtc_state->active = true;
+
+       ret = drm_atomic_set_crtc_for_plane(primary_state, crtc);
+       if (ret != 0)
+               return ret;
+
+       drm_mode_get_hv_timing(set->mode, &hdisplay, &vdisplay);
+
+       drm_atomic_set_fb_for_plane(primary_state, set->fb);
+       primary_state->crtc_x = 0;
+       primary_state->crtc_y = 0;
+       primary_state->crtc_w = hdisplay;
+       primary_state->crtc_h = vdisplay;
+       primary_state->src_x = set->x << 16;
+       primary_state->src_y = set->y << 16;
+       if (drm_rotation_90_or_270(primary_state->rotation)) {
+               primary_state->src_w = vdisplay << 16;
+               primary_state->src_h = hdisplay << 16;
+       } else {
+               primary_state->src_w = hdisplay << 16;
+               primary_state->src_h = vdisplay << 16;
+       }
+
+commit:
+       ret = update_output_state(state, set);
+       if (ret)
+               return ret;
+
+       return 0;
+}
+EXPORT_SYMBOL(drm_atomic_set_config);
+
